SigBridgeR: An Integrative Framework and Toolkit for Comprehensive Screening and Benchmarking of Phenotype-Associated Cell Subpopulations in Single-Cell Transcriptomics

2026-05-12

Abstract excerpt

Single-cell RNA sequencing has revolutionized our understanding of cellular heterogeneity, yet linking specific cell subpopulations to clinically relevant phenotypes remains a persistent challenge.
